Ambiq is on a mission to enable intelligence everywhere — powering the AI edge revolution with the world's lowest-power semiconductor solutions.
Built on our proprietary sub- and near-threshold technology, our chips deliver multi-fold improvements in energy efficiency without costly process scaling. Since 2010, we've shipped over 300 million units to customers building smarter wearables, medical devices, IoT products, and AI-powered edge applications.
Our cross-functional teams span design, research, development, production, marketing, sales, and operations across Austin, Hsinchu, Shanghai, Shenzhen, and Singapore. As a senior radio software engineer at Ambiq, you will drive wireless software development for the Apollo Blue family and develop wireless software solutions (implement specifications, design software, and unit test). This role will work with different cross-functional teams to integrate and debug wireless components on the company’s platform. Perform code review, code optimization, refactoring, bug hunting, and bug fixing.
The successful candidate must be intimately familiar with OpenThread, have extensive experience in developing deeply embedded applications for wireless silicon, and be good at analyzing RF and firmware issues using an air sniffer, logic analyzer, etc. The person in this role will be responsible for scoping software development work, delegating tasks, identifying resource/technical gaps, and taking the initiative to tackle challenging technical issues by seeking support from across teams.
